Posted

When I first open your document in Designer and go straight to export, setting the Area to “Selection Area” I get the same 'problem' preview and export as you.

However, if I de-select what’s selected, then select the white background rectangle, and then go back to the Export Dialog (still with Area set to “Selection Area”) I don’t get the extra white space.

But, when I drag-select the area containing the layers you want to export I get the same problem as originally.

I don’t know why this should be at the moment – could it be because the white rectangle is rotated by 90 degrees?

If you click the chain icon between the size fields to turn off aspect ration you can then enter 800 and 400 into these fields and this will be the dimension that is exported.
